ビットコイン(BTC)将来性を左右する技術面の進展
はじめに
ビットコイン(BTC)は、2009年の誕生以来、金融システムに革新をもたらす可能性を秘めた暗号資産として注目を集めてきました。その将来性は、単なる価格変動だけでなく、基盤となる技術の進展に大きく左右されます。本稿では、ビットコインの将来性を左右する主要な技術面の進展について、詳細に解説します。特に、スケーラビリティ問題、プライバシー保護技術、スマートコントラクト機能、セキュリティ強化、そして量子コンピュータ耐性といった側面に着目し、それぞれの現状と今後の展望を考察します。
1. スケーラビリティ問題とその解決策
ビットコインの初期設計における最も大きな課題の一つが、スケーラビリティ問題です。ブロックチェーンのブロックサイズが限られているため、取引処理能力が低く、取引手数料が高騰する可能性があります。この問題を解決するために、様々な技術的アプローチが提案・実装されています。
- セグウィット(SegWit):2017年に導入されたセグウィットは、ブロックの構造を変更することで、実質的なブロックサイズを拡大し、取引処理能力を向上させました。また、取引手数料の削減にも貢献しています。
- ライトニングネットワーク(Lightning Network):オフチェーンのスケーリングソリューションであるライトニングネットワークは、ビットコインブロックチェーンの外で多数の小規模な取引を処理することで、スケーラビリティ問題を解決しようとしています。これにより、高速かつ低コストな取引が可能になります。
- サイドチェーン(Sidechain):ビットコインのメインチェーンとは独立したブロックチェーンであるサイドチェーンは、異なるルールセットを持つことができ、特定のアプリケーションに最適化された取引処理を可能にします。
- ブロックサイズの拡大:一部のコミュニティでは、ブロックサイズを拡大することでスケーラビリティ問題を解決しようとしていますが、これは中央集権化のリスクを高める可能性があるため、議論が続いています。
これらの解決策は、それぞれ異なる特徴とトレードオフを持っています。今後のビットコインのスケーラビリティは、これらの技術の組み合わせと最適化によって決定されるでしょう。
2. プライバシー保護技術の進化
ビットコインの取引は、擬似匿名性を持つとされていますが、ブロックチェーン上に取引履歴が公開されているため、プライバシーが完全に保護されているわけではありません。プライバシー保護技術の進化は、ビットコインの普及と利用を促進するために不可欠です。
- CoinJoin:複数のユーザーが取引をまとめて行うことで、個々の取引の追跡を困難にする技術です。
- MimbleWimble:ブロックチェーン上の取引情報を削減し、プライバシーを向上させるプロトコルです。
- Confidential Transactions:取引金額を暗号化することで、取引内容を隠蔽する技術です。
- Taproot:シュノル署名(Schnorr signatures)を導入し、複雑なスマートコントラクトをより効率的に処理し、プライバシーを向上させるアップグレードです。
これらの技術は、ビットコインのプライバシー保護を強化し、より多くのユーザーが安心してビットコインを利用できるようにするでしょう。
3. スマートコントラクト機能の拡張
ビットコインの初期設計には、スマートコントラクト機能は限定的でしたが、Taprootの導入により、スマートコントラクト機能が拡張されました。これにより、ビットコイン上でより複雑なアプリケーションを構築することが可能になります。
- Tapscript:Taprootで導入された新しいスクリプト言語であり、より柔軟で効率的なスマートコントラクトの作成を可能にします。
- RGB(Really Generic Bitcoin):ビットコインブロックチェーン上に、トークンやその他のデジタル資産を発行するためのプロトコルです。
- Federated Sidechains:複数の当事者が共同で管理するサイドチェーンであり、特定のアプリケーションに最適化されたスマートコントラクトを実行できます。
スマートコントラクト機能の拡張は、ビットコインのユースケースを拡大し、DeFi(分散型金融)などの新しいアプリケーションを促進するでしょう。
4. セキュリティ強化の取り組み
ビットコインのセキュリティは、その信頼性と安定性を維持するために最も重要な要素の一つです。ビットコインのセキュリティ強化には、様々な取り組みが行われています。
- ハードウェアウォレットの普及:秘密鍵をオフラインで保管することで、ハッキングのリスクを軽減します。
- マルチシグ(Multi-signature):複数の署名が必要な取引を可能にし、セキュリティを向上させます。
- ブロックチェーンの監視と分析:不正な取引や攻撃を検知し、迅速に対応します。
- プロトコルのアップデートと脆弱性の修正:定期的なプロトコルのアップデートにより、セキュリティ脆弱性を修正し、セキュリティを向上させます。
これらの取り組みは、ビットコインのセキュリティを強化し、ユーザーの資産を保護するために不可欠です。
5. 量子コンピュータ耐性への対策
量子コンピュータの開発が進むにつれて、現在の暗号技術が破られるリスクが高まっています。ビットコインのセキュリティも、量子コンピュータの脅威にさらされる可能性があります。量子コンピュータ耐性への対策は、ビットコインの長期的な存続のために不可欠です。
- 耐量子暗号アルゴリズムの導入:現在の暗号アルゴリズムを、量子コンピュータに対しても安全な耐量子暗号アルゴリズムに置き換える必要があります。
- ポスト量子暗号の研究開発:耐量子暗号アルゴリズムの研究開発を加速し、より安全で効率的なアルゴリズムを開発する必要があります。
- ハイブリッドアプローチ:従来の暗号アルゴリズムと耐量子暗号アルゴリズムを組み合わせることで、セキュリティを向上させることができます。
量子コンピュータ耐性への対策は、時間と労力を要する課題ですが、ビットコインの将来性を確保するためには、積極的に取り組む必要があります。
まとめ
ビットコインの将来性は、スケーラビリティ問題の解決、プライバシー保護技術の進化、スマートコントラクト機能の拡張、セキュリティ強化、そして量子コンピュータ耐性への対策といった技術面の進展に大きく左右されます。これらの技術は、それぞれ異なる課題と機会を秘めており、今後のビットコインの開発と普及に重要な役割を果たすでしょう。ビットコインが真にグローバルな金融システムの一部となるためには、これらの技術的な課題を克服し、より安全で効率的で使いやすい暗号資産へと進化していく必要があります。技術革新は継続的に行われ、ビットコインは常に変化し続けるでしょう。その変化を理解し、適応していくことが、ビットコインの将来性を最大限に引き出すための鍵となります。